Output 58f6636689364a60d8fc1802b22820c7f8f167020e28fb737a88824a7db51ef8:30

value
120793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2b56f4da400b9d3a06c7e452ba3f197cb45eec OP_EQUAL
address
3QVnmo3YR5CoKLfXQJeKTMnE7dGNRPfniN
transaction
58f6636689364a60d8fc1802b22820c7f8f167020e28fb737a88824a7db51ef8